Just backed the A-frame and truck down the drive at home, went around the corner to see the 2 year-old grandson, and had a beer (a Big Sky Brewing Moose Drool) while putting a few trip stats together: 

 

4,999 miles driven (Raleigh, NC to Philipsburg, MT and back), $1,050 in diesel burned, 20 days away from home, fuel mileage while towing average in the 13.5 mpg range, four chance encounters with North Carolinians in MT and WY, three new friends made, two absolutely seat cover ripping descents, one river run in a livestock tank, and zero accesses of my office email account.  Oh, and one very happy bride. 

 

Terrific trip.  This is one heckuva country.  Found some places to take the grandson to in a few years, and met some genuine new friends.
